Why age claims require verification
Horses, like many species, rarely have precise birth dates in natural settings unless breeding is intentionally managed and recorded. Without documents or permanent identification, it is difficult to confirm a horse’s true age, leading to contradictory claims. Reliable age evidence typically includes:
- Official registration papers with birth date
- Microchip or freeze branding records
- Veterinary health records tied to known dates
- Historic herd or farm logbooks with consistent timestamps
Claims lacking these forms should be treated as unverified anecdotes rather than factual records.

How horse age is determined
Methods used by veterinarians and registries
Professionals combine multiple approaches to estimate or confirm age:
- Teeth eruption and wear patterns — used for young to middle-aged horses
- Dental records and previous veterinary exams
- Microchip scanning and registry database checks
- DNA sampling in disputed cases where parentage and birth dates are available
These methods are most reliable when based on early-life documentation rather than retrospective guesswork.
Biological and management factors in equine longevity
A horse’s lifespan depends on genetics, breed tendencies, nutrition, veterinary care, and living conditions. Generally:
- Average domestic horses live 25–30 years
- Well-managed companions in optimal conditions regularly reach 30–40 years
- Exceptional outliers documented in verified cases can exceed 40 years, but these are rare
Good farrier care, routine dentistry, balanced diet, parasite control, and low-stress environments support longer, healthier lives.
